Methyl 2-bromo-5-fluoro-3-iodobenzoate

Methyl 2-bromo-5-fluoro-3-iodobenzoate

2623-U-03
%
1499694-56-2
MFCD24107084
C8H5BrFIO2
358.933
Units Price (USD) Availability

Recommended Products

Previous Next
Properties
Downloads
Safety
Regulatory

TSCA: Not listed on TSCA inventory